File zte-mf.spec of Package beeline-home-internet-tools
Name: zte-mf-tools
Version: 0.0.2
Release: 3
Summary: ZTE MF626 modem utils
License: GPLv2+
Group: Applications/Communications
Source0: zte-mf.tar.gz
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
Requires(post): /sbin/udevcontrol
#Requires(preun): /sbin/udevcontrol
#Requires(preun): /sbin/service
Requires(postun): /sbin/udevcontrol
Requires: /sbin/modprobe
BuildRequires: libusb-devel
%description -l ru
Утилиты для работы с модемами ZTE из комлекта «Билайн Интернет Дома»
%prep
%setup -q -c
%build
make
%install
rm -rf $RPM_BUILD_ROOT
install -Dm 664 zte-mf.rules $RPM_BUILD_ROOT%{_sysconfdir}/udev/rules.d/zte-mf.rules
install -Dm 755 zte-mf-helper-run $RPM_BUILD_ROOT%{_sbindir}/zte-mf-helper-run
install -Dm 755 mf626-helper $RPM_BUILD_ROOT%{_sbindir}/mf626-helper
%clean
rm -rf $RPM_BUILD_ROOT
%post
if [ $1 -eq 0 ]; then
/sbin/udevcontrol reload_rules
fi
%postun
if [ $1 -ge 1 ]; then
/sbin/udevcontrol reload_rules
fi
%files
%defattr(-,root,root,-)
%{_sbindir}/*
%config(noreplace) %{_sysconfdir}/udev/rules.d/zte-mf.rules
%changelog
* Sun Dec 21 2008 val 0.0.1
- Initial spec.